Your Target does not at all match what is in the documentation. The numeric OID you have specified does not exists as a value in the Squid MIB, and the error message is thus fully correct as MRTG can not plot things that does not exists.
.1.3.6.1.4.1.3495.1.1.1 is enterprise.nlanr.Squid.cacheSystem. Why do you specify the OID numerically? It is much easier to load the Squid MIB into MRTG and then specify the OID by name.
